Delving into Volvo VECU Systems: From EC210 to EC290

Volvo's Vehicle Electronic Control Unit (VECU) systems have evolved significantly over the years, with models ranging from the older EC210 to the more recent EC290. These sophisticated units manage a vast system of electronic components within a Volvo vehicle, ensuring optimal performance, fuel efficiency, and safety. Understanding the operation of these systems is crucial for both mechanics and enthusiasts alike.

VECU systems employ a variety of sensors to acquire data about the vehicle's surroundings. This information is then processed by powerful microprocessors, which generate commands to control various subsystems such as the engine, transmission, and brakes. The EC210 model, while previous, laid the foundation for future VECU advancements, with its priority on basic control functions.

Subsequent models like the EC290 demonstrate a marked enhancement in complexity and capability. They feature advanced algorithms for tasks such as engine optimization, emission control, and driver assistance systems. Furthermore, EC290 models often harness CAN bus technology to enable seamless communication between various electronic components.

  • Diagnosing issues within a VECU system can often require specialized tools and expertise.
  • Complex diagnostic software is necessary for technicians to examine real-time data from the VECU and determine the source of any problems.
